Nabire, also known as the District of Nabire, is a town in the Indonesian province of Central Papua, at the western end of New Guinea. The town is the administrative seat of the Nabire Regency. It is served by Douw Aturure Airport.[2]

Geography

The town lies on the northern coast of the island on Cenderawasih Bay.

Climate

Nabire has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) with heavy to very heavy rainfall year-round.

Attractions

Nabire a tourist resort, with numerous attractions, including:

  • sea garden of Cenderawasih bay with 130 species of coral,
  • Wahario Beach also known as Gedo Beach Youth Tourism Park, is located in Sanoba Village.[4]
  • Pepaya island with ideal conditions for diving,
  • hot springs, water temperature up to 80 °C.
